    Needless to say, I was not surprised to find out that Apple has come out tops in Laptop Mag‘s annual tech support showdown, designed to help customers determine which companies are offering the most reliable customer service in the tech industry.

    Here’s MacRumors with the details:

    Apple received an aggregate score of 91, earning 54 points [out of 60] for its web-based tech support and 37 points [out of 40] for its phone-based tech support. Laptop Mag says that Apple’s support staff are among the “fastest and most knowledgeable,” offering up “accurate answers” to Mac questions across live chat, social media, and the phone
